India'S Garment Export Value Has Declined For Three Consecutive Months

Indian Clothing Exports

In July, Indian clothing Exports fell for the third consecutive month, down 22.5% year on year, but in July, the overall national exports grew 13.2%.


According to the report of the Garment Export Promotion Council (AEPC) market demand As a result, exports decreased to 816 million dollars in July.


Premal Udani, president of India Garment Export Promotion Association, said that the demand of western markets, such as the United States and Europe, has not yet recovered Economic recovery Slow.


The United States and the European Union accounted for about 80% of India's clothing exports, and India's clothing exports totaled US $10.64 billion in 2009-10.


From April to July in 2010-11, clothing exports decreased by 8% year-on-year to US $3.46 billion.


In contrast, from April to July, India's overall exports totaled US $68.63 billion, up 30.1% year on year.


In July this year, the overall export increased by 13.2% to US $16.24 billion.


Although the government recently revised its foreign trade policy and announced that the preferential measures of the Market Linked Key Products Program (MLFPS) for the EU would be extended to March 21, 2011, the industry still hopes that exports to the United States can share this preferential measure.


According to the MLFPS plan, exporters can get 2% of the export value reward.
